This is a plane that was forced to land on the black sand beach in southern Iceland due to lack of fuel half a century ago. The accident did not cause any casualties and the crew survived. However, because the recycling cost is too high, the aircraft wreckage has been abandoned after the removal of the main instrument. Near Vick, Slheimasandurs black beach aircraft wreck in the south of Iceland is not allowed to pass by. It can only be parked outside, and then walk about 4 kilometers to the gravel road for about 2 hours. Try to go before 10am, and its not good to take pictures when you go late. If you go to the Aurora in the middle of the night, it will be even more perfect. Under normal circumstances, the wind is very large. It is best to wear windproof clothes when hiking, cover your face with a scarf or a mask, and put on gloves. Although I walked for 2 hours just to see the wreckage of a plane, and there was no scenery on the road, it was very shocking to see it.
